C.1780-1800 Chinese Export Huge Clobbered Blue and White Nanking Fabulous Mug/Tankard that measures 4 7/8" in height and the opening diameter is 3 7/8". The clobbering process is painting and gilding to an already completed process. The handle is double strapped that never has been broken. This Fabulous cider jug is in Fabulous Condition with only a bubble burst along the very rim which is shown in the images. No chips, cracks or Restoration to this unusual mug.

19TH Century Oil on 16" X 20" Board of Winter Snow Mountain
Landscape with Cabins and Pine Trees. Signed by Josepha Newcomb Whitney (painter and art teacher) who was born in Washington, D.C. in 1872. This nice painting set in a nice gilded wood frame measuring 20" X 24".
Good Condition. I feel it was painted when the artist studied in New Haven, CT. and in Woodstock, NY. Listed in Davenport's Art Reference and Price Guide. Fieldings(2) Mallett(1)Who is Who in American ...click for details
